Understanding the Importance of Test Plans in Engineering

Constructing test plans is vital in both product and software development. Skilled engineers determine what features to test and establish performance metrics, ensuring quality and reliability. This foundational process helps identify potential issues before products hit the market, highlighting the crucial role of informed decision-making in engineering practices.

The Heart of Test Plans: Why Choices Matter in Engineering

When it comes to engineering, there’s one vital question that often gets overlooked: how do you ensure a product functions as intended before it hits the market? Think about it—imagine launching a device that doesn’t work properly. Ouch, right? That’s where the delicate art of test planning steps in. If you’ve heard the statement, “when constructing test plans, skilled labor must decide what features to test and how to evaluate performance,” you might be itching to know if it’s true or false. Spoiler: It’s true!

Let’s break it down, yeah?

The Role of Skilled Labor in Test Planning

At the heart of any effective test plan is the skillful hands of engineers and testers. These folks aren't just pushing buttons; they’re experts who need to delve into the nitty-gritty of a product's design and functionality. Imagine being a chef crafting a new dish—you have to think about what ingredients to include, right? Similarly, testers decide what features to evaluate to ensure a product meets the highest quality standards.

Let me explain a bit more. This involves looking at everything from how the product operates to how users will interact with it. It’s like being a detective, uncovering what works and what doesn’t while sniffing out potential flaws before they wreak havoc on user experience. It’s crucial, and here’s why: if a feature is overlooked during testing, it might lead to significant issues down the line. And guess what? Nobody wants customers returning products with a “not satisfied” stamp.

Setting the Benchmark: Evaluating Performance

Once the features that need testing are established, the conversation shifts to performance evaluation. This is where skilled labor shines in defining benchmarks and methodologies. Think of benchmarks as the standard by which you measure performance—the gold star every product wants to achieve.

So, how do engineers go about this? They create specific metrics that can effectively gauge whether a product meets its specifications and user expectations. It’s like setting the rules for a game; if you don’t know what needs to be accomplished, how can you measure success?

And this isn’t just limited to engineering marvels like cars or smartphones. In the world of software testing, the principles remain the same. Tough software bugs can be more disruptive than finding a fly in your soup, so understanding what to test and how to evaluate results is essential.

The Big Picture: Reliability Matters

After everything is said and done, a well-structured test plan is about more than just ticking off boxes. It’s about establishing a reliable testing process that ensures quality. Without this, products are like boats without sails, potentially floating adrift when they hit the market.

Let’s pause for a moment to appreciate the stakes here. Quality assurance isn’t merely a checkbox; it’s the difference between success and failure in the marketplace. When a certain feature of a product is tested and meets performance expectations, customers are more likely to trust that product. That's invaluable! You have to ask yourself: wouldn’t you rather have confidence in the technology you’re investing in?

The Consistency Across the Board

Now, here’s something interesting. This principle of ensuring quality through focused testing doesn’t just apply to products, but extends seamlessly to software testing as well. Yes, the same rigorous evaluation criteria exist across the board. Whether you’re working on a physical gadget or a piece of software, understanding what needs testing and how to measure it is fundamental.

It’s kind of like realizing that your favorite pizza place also makes a killer pasta dish—you’d expect the same level of care and attention to detail, wouldn’t you? The same reasoning applies to different domains within engineering.

Avoiding Common Pitfalls

However, it’s easy to fall into tricky traps when test planning. You might be tempted to rush things or skip over detailed planning to save time. But here’s the thing: a little extra time spent upfront can save a mountain of headache later. Tests that seem trivial can lead to discovering significant flaws, sometimes too late.

Here’s a thought: What if you could adopt a systematic approach to evaluating new features and performance? That way, you wouldn’t just have a solid test plan; you’d have a reliable blueprint for product success. Plus, with every product tested properly, you contribute to building a culture of quality that transcends entire organizations.

Conclusion: The Path Ahead

As we wrap things up, it’s clear that constructing test plans and making informed decisions about what features to test and how to measure performance isn’t just busywork. It's the backbone of successful engineering practices across the board, both in product and software development.

So, next time you hear that statement about skilled labor’s crucial role in testing, you’ll know the truth. A solid testing foundation built on skilled expertise leads to reliable outcomes. After all, what’s better than knowing your product not only works but exceeds expectations? You nailed it! The road ahead is filled with possibilities, but only if you take the right steps from the start. Happy engineering!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y